Tapioca Beiju Recipe

Want to learn how to make tapioca beiju easy? At Specialfood we show you how! This Brazilian delicacy has indigenous origin and is prepared with cassava starch, popularly known as tapioca gum or sweet powder. Check out the walkthrough below and try it out!

Ingredients for making tapioca Beiju:

 500 grams of tapioca gum or sweet powder

 Water

 1 pinch of salt

 stuffing to taste

How to make tapioca Beiju:

To prepare tapioca beiju you need tapioca gum, available at any supermarket. Make sure the gum you are using is dry or moistened. Alternatively you can also use sweet powder, in which case you will have to hydrate according to the step below.

If using dry tapioca gum or sweet powder, add a pinch of salt and a little water. Mix it well with your hands until it crumbles (if it's too wet, add more gum).

Whether you're using dry or wet tapioca gum or manioc flour, the next step in tapioca beiju is to sift this "flour" to get only the smallest grains.

Place a frying pan over medium-low heat and spread the smaller grains from the previous step in it. Leave for approximately 1 minute and when you see that the beans have stuck together, turn it over, like a pancake.

After the previous step, you are free to fill your tapioca beiju with whatever you prefer! Some people prefer simple fillings, such as butter and rennet cheese, others use condensed milk or ham and cheese... it's just right! Add the filling and fold the tapioca in half.

Heat the tapioca beiju a little more on both sides and, after that, it's ready to serve, as a snack, main dish or dessert. Enjoy your food!
